Train Ticket Booking Rules: Railways changed the rules of train ticket booking; Now you will be able to make reservations only so many days in advance

Rail Ticket Reservation Rules: During festival or wedding season, it becomes very difficult to get confirmed train tickets, due to which people book tickets many months in advance. However, now Railways has made a big change regarding ticket reservation. Under which railway passengers will now be able to book tickets only 60 days in advance.

Actually, at present railway passengers can reserve train tickets 120 days in advance. But from November 1, passengers will be able to book tickets only 60 days in advance. The Ministry of Railways has issued this order on Thursday. However, the ministry's order will not affect tickets booked till October 31 and passengers will be able to book tickets 120 days in advance. Passengers will also be able to cancel those tickets which have more than 60 days left for their departure.

On the other hand, this rule will not have any impact on trains like Taj Express and Gomti Express running during the day time. The time limit will continue to be the same as before. Apart from this, tickets for foreign tourist trains can be booked 365 days in advance as before.
